They were sitting with eachother on the same log just like yesterday and many other days. Hand in hand beside eachother.

The sun was setting, creating a beautiful scene that was unfolding in front of their eyes.

He looked at her. Her brown eyes were shining just like the sun and a small smile was playing on her lips. All of sudden he tightened his hold on her hand and squeezed it a bit, "Marry Me."

She wasn't shocked. She knew that how much he loves her. Still,with a small smile she turned to him and said, "I would love to do that.But my father doesn't have enough money to give you."

"I m not asking for your father's money. I don't want dowry or any other thing. I just want your father's consent and your presence in my life", he said gazing at her beautiful face.

Nodding her head she said "Lets go then. I m ready to face him and tell him about us." Now he was shocked. She agreed just like that...!!

They went and explained everything to her father. He said the same thing that his daughter told awhile ago.

He assured her father that he doesn't want anything except for her.

Next day they got married in the nearest registrar office. Both were happy. So were the family members.

Married Life begins.......

They were living their blissful life after getting wedded. He had recently started working in a company that is a bit far from their place.

As for her, she was living her dream. Her only dream. Him. Love him. Marry him. Be with him. Forever and ever......

After three months...........

One day he came out of their room wearing a pink shirt and grey pants, searching for her.

There she was, clad in her blue saree, looking as beautiful as ever. Waiting near the door with her dazzling smile and holding his office bag and bike keys. Grabbing his things from her, he dropped a kiss on her forehead and left.

After one and half hour, the news came that he got in an accident and died on the spot.

He is dead.

She was broken and devastated. Her dream broke into a harsh reality. Her husband broke all the promises and left her alone.

After his funeral ceremony, someone handed her his clothes. That pink shirt he wore before he died.

But there were blood stains on it. She wanted a clean shirt of him. So she went to the nearest laundry and gave it to the laundry worker.

"This stain won't come out. I think there is nothing that could be able to remove  the stain. Its better if you just throw this shirt in the garbage", said the laundry man.

A few days later she met her friend who advised her not to waste time for a shirt,"That stain won't come out.....!"

Now, she was determined to get that shirt as clean as it was before getting stained. And now she will do that by herself. After all Its his shirt which he wore during his last breath and she is definitely not gonna lose it.
